我正在尝试使用Magmi在2家商店查看更新价格,但我遇到了问题。这是我的设置。
网站名称(代码:bab) 商店名称(根类别:BAB)
有2个店铺视图 Storeview 1(代码:abc) Storeview 2(代码:bab)
由于我只是想更新storeviews的价格,我的csv文件如下: 商店,网站,sku,价格 admin,faf,1001,5.00 admin,gpf,1001,7.00
不幸的是价格根本不需要更新。只有1个商店的价格更新,而另一个没有。
我尝试过以不同方式导入。
这些方法都没有将价格应用于两者。我或者只获得1次价格更新。或者我在1商店中获得默认价格,而其他商店根本没有更新。
我还在每次magmi导入后重新编制索引,清除了magento缓存和我的chrome缓存。
我还检查过以确保没有影响任何产品的折扣或定价规则。
所以我希望有人可以告诉我任何我做错的事或我需要检查的其他事情。也许我正在配置我的csv文件错误?
Nore:我有超过5000种产品,而且我认为我不能使用磁力列表的默认导入功能/数据配置文件,因为它非常慢并且通常只会崩溃。
谢谢,希望你能提供帮助。非常感谢。 保罗
答案 0 :(得分:1)
如magmi支持中所述:http://sourceforge.net/p/magmi/support-requests/121/#9fbb
使用多线索,你必须改变"存储"列放置商店代码,而不是"网站"柱。 这里:
store,sku, price
abc, 1001, 5.00
bab, 1001, 7.00
这应该可以解决您的问题
答案 1 :(得分:0)
打开magmi / engines / magmi_productimportengine.php并添加此条件
if ($attrcode == "price" && $attrdesc["is_configurable"] == 1){
$scope=0;
}
在
if ($attrcode != "price" && $attrdesc["is_configurable"] == 1)
{
$scope = 0;
}